Ball milling as an important pretreatment technique in ...

The load exerted by grinding balls on lignocellulosic biomass in a vibratory ball mill is significantly larger than the other mill types, resulting in the highest enzymatic hydrolysis yield. The glucose yields achieved were 95.2, 75.2, 61.0, and 52.8%, for vibratory ball mill, tumbler ball mill, jet mill, and centrifugal mill, respectively ...

The Anatomy of an End Mill - In The Loupe

The overall reach of an end mill, or length below shank (LBS), is a dimension that describes the necked length of reached tools. It is measured from the start of the necked portion to the bottom of the cutting end of the tool. The neck relief allows space for chip evacuation and prevents the shank from rubbing in deep- pocket milling applications.

What is Alodine / Chem Film / Chromate Conversion …

What is Alodine ®?Also known as chem film or chemfilm, Alodine ® is a chromate conversion coating that protects aluminum and other metals from corrosion. Related products include Iridite ®, TCP-HF, and Bonderite ®.The process of applying a chromate conversion coating is referred to as chromating.. Chromate conversion coatings are a type of chemical conversion coating.

Machining Aluminum on a CNC Router - Explore …

For finishing operations, especially 3D ones with a ball-end mill – a "pre-finishing" approach will really help make the final surface nice. To do this you just make a set of operations that are the same as your finishing paths, but that leave a small bit of material (.02″ / 0.5mm) and use a larger step-over by 2 to 4X.

Direct Mechanocatalysis: Using Milling Balls as Catalysts ...

In vibratory ball mills the vessels are subjected to a horizontal, vertical or elliptical arc. Due to sudden changes in the direction the balls inside the vessel are colliding with the wall and each other. In this type of mill usually only a few balls (one to four) and rather simple and small milling jars are utilized.
